Mallow
Mallow is an extremely sensitive boy who has come to us from a breeder. We are told that he is a Poodle cross, and we believe this may be with a Bernese as he is quite a large boy, although we cannot be certain. When he first arrived, he was very flighty when being handled and would need an experienced home where he could learn about trust and companionship. Over the past few weeks, however, he has made lovely progress and is now starting to enjoy affection from people he knows and trusts. He is a truly sweet boy who will make a wonderful companion for the right family.
Mallow walks nicely on his harness and is becoming braver with the people, dogs, and new experiences he comes across on his walks. He also really enjoys spending time in the large, secure play yard. He is fantastic with other dogs, both big and small, male and female, and will need the confidence and support of a kind resident dog in the home to help him continue building his confidence and settle into family life.
He could share his home with older, dog-savvy teenagers aged 16 and over who understand that he will need a gentle and quiet introduction to the home, along with his own safe space to relax and settle.
As Mallow has never lived in a home environment, his adopters will need to be patient and understanding as he learns about house training and daily routines. While he is doing well on a lead, he may benefit from starting with gentle garden time in a secure space before gradually exploring the world once he feels comfortable.
Mallow is currently on a gastro diet after previously having a sensitive tummy, which has now improved. His new family will need to continue managing this to keep him feeling his best. He shares toys, beds, and food well with other dogs, although he is currently fed separately to ensure he only eats his specialist food.
Our vets have also noted a slightly inflamed right shoulder. This is not causing him any issues at present but should be monitored.
Mallow is a handsome, gentle, and affectionate boy who has come such a long way already and just needs a kind and patient family to help him continue to blossom.
